Obituary for Johnson


Published in the Albuquerque Journal on Wednesday June 28, 2000

Mark E. Johnson, a resident of Albuquerque, passed away June 22, 2000. Mark was born on June 21, 1948 to Bennie and Louise Smith Johnson in Charleston, WV. He was presently employed at St. Joseph's Hospital and was a member of the American Assoc. of Respiratory Therapists. Mark was a graduate of Nassau Community College and was a Cub Scout Den leader. He is survived by his beloved wife, Linda; three children, Timothy, Rachael, and Bryant; and his mother, Louise Johnson Kersten, all of Albuquerque. Mark is also survived by his sister,"Chickie" Johnson of Rio Rancho; brothers, Tom and wife, Carol of Albuquerque, Allen and wife, Carol of Rio Rancho, Paul Johnson and Christin of Rio Rancho; mother-in-law, Felicia Grey of Florida; brother-in-law, Chris and wife, Janine Grey of New York; sister-in-law, Doreen and husband, Wayne Bachelor of Florida; and many nieces and nephews. Mark was a very loving husband, father and son, and will be dearly missed by all of his family and friends. A Memorial service for Mark will be held on Thursday, June 29, 2000 at 2:00 p.m. in the Chapel of Rio Rancho Funeral Home. In lieu of flowers, memorial donations may be made to the St. Joseph's Hospital Employee Emergency Fund.
